Abstract: | We present an implementation framework for run-time reconfigurable systems. The framework provides a methodology and a design representation which allow to plug in different design tools. Front-end tools cover design capture, temporal partitioning and scheduling; back-end tools provide reconfiguration control, communication channel generation, estimation, and the final code composition. This paper discusses two of the framework main issues, the design representation and the hierarchical reconfiguration approach for multi-FPGA systems. |
